Steaks at Saltgrass vary significantly in calorie count based on the cut and size. Leaner options like the are lower in calories compared to marbelized cuts like the Bone-In Ribeye . Maudeen's Center-Cut Filet (6 oz.) : ~550 calories. Wagon Boss Center-Cut Top Sirloin (8 oz.) : ~540 calories. Pat's Ribeye (12 oz.) : ~960 calories. Silver Star Porterhouse (22 oz.) : ~1,520 calories. Atlantic Salmon (Simply Grilled) : ~480 calories. Grilled Chicken Breast : ~560 calories. Appetizers and Small Bites
